On this episode of Million Dollaz Worth of Game, we tap in with Florida’s own Yungeen Ace for a powerful and raw convo at the studio. Ace opens up about his rough upbringing, growing up in poverty, and the pain he turned into purpose. From losing close friends to rising as one of the hottest names in the game.
